Description

This security bulletin contains information about 2 secuirty vulnerabilities.


1) Resource management error (CVE-ID: CVE-2024-31146)

The vulnerability allows a malicious guest to escalate privileges on the system.

The vulnerability exists due to improper management of shared resources when using PCI pass-through. A malicious guest can escalate privileges on the system.


2) Improper error handling (CVE-ID: CVE-2024-31145)

The vulnerability allows a malicious guest to escalate privileges on the system.

The vulnerability exists due to improper error handling in x86 IOMMU identity mapping. A malicious guest can access memory regions related to other guests or the hypervisor.
